  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/SAPAPO/AMON_LIST151 - Data not complete ?
    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/AMON_LIST151 Data not complete typically occurs in the context of S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) when there is missing or incomplete data required for a specific operation or report. This error can arise in various scenarios, such as during planning runs, data extraction, or when generating reports.
    Causes:
    
    Missing Master Data: The error may occur if there are missing master data records (e.g., materials, locations, or resources) that are required for the planning process.
    Incomplete Transaction Data: If the transaction data (like sales orders, purchase orders, or stock levels) is incomplete or not updated, it can lead to this error.
    
    Configuration Issues: Incorrect configuration settings in the APO system can also lead to incomplete data scenarios. Data Transfer Issues: Problems during data transfer from SAP ERP to SAP APO can result in incomplete datasets.
